Window Well Waterproofing in Overland Park, KS
Window well waterproofing services are designed to protect basement windows and their surrounding areas from water intrusion and moisture buildup. This service typically involves sealing and waterproofing window wells, installing drainage systems, and applying protective coatings to prevent water from seeping into the basement. Projects may include upgrading existing window wells, installing new wells in areas prone to flooding, or repairing damage caused by water infiltration. Property owners often seek this service to prevent basement flooding, reduce mold growth, and maintain the structural integrity of their foundation.
Before requesting window well waterproofing,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work, the materials used, and how the waterproofing will be integrated with existing landscaping or drainage systems. It’s also helpful to know whether the service includes addressing any existing water issues or damage. Clear communication about the specific challenges of the property, such as heavy rainfall or poor drainage, can help ensure the waterproofing solution effectively protects the basement and prolongs the lifespan of the window wells.

Window Well Waterproofing Questions
What is window well waterproofing? It involves sealing and protecting window wells to prevent water from leaking into basements or lower levels during heavy rain or snowmelt.
Why is waterproofing important for window wells? Proper waterproofing helps avoid water damage, mold growth, and foundation issues caused by water infiltration around basement windows.
What types of waterproofing methods are used? Common methods include applying sealants, installing drainage systems, and adding protective covers to keep water out of window wells.
Who should consider window well waterproofing? Property owners with below-grade windows or those experiencing water pooling around window wells should consider waterproofing solutions.
